Patrick James - Black Talent Initiative

"As a recent university graduate, the Black Talent Initiative (BTI) provided me with the answers to questions and scenarios that appear in the real world. This initiative is what I needed to help navigate the job market and define my career goals. The availability of numerous mentors who were willing to meet with me allowed me to rebrand myself for the role I wanted. Moreover, they connected me with specific opportunities and people to learn more about the role and potential organizations. As a result, I was able to find employment at one of the best marketing agencies in the country and one that aligned with my career goals. In addition, I am honoured to be a part of the BTI Marketing & Communications team as we grow the brand’s awareness, partner with allies, and help young Black professionals find careers. As a volunteer, I have heard the issues among many organizations that recognize the need for diverse talent and willingness to collaborate."

Patrick James - Account Coordinator, Cossette

WHY INTERNSHIPS AND ENTRY-LEVEL ROLES?

Black representation in Canada’s business community is significantly below other racialized groups

 

Diverse organizations are proven winners on multiple business metrics

 

Diverse internships can help shape and improve your organizations through individual knowledge, attitudes and behaviours
